membership相关内容

向成员资格提供程序添加密码要求

我是需要创建自定义成员资格提供程序,还是有其他方法? 我有一个使用ASP.NET窗体身份验证和Microsoft SQL成员资格提供程序的项目。网站已经完成了。我在任何地方都使用这个供应商。(注册、登录、忘记密码等...) 到目前为止,我的网站用户还不需要复杂的密码。用户的密码实际上只是PIN。在过去,用户可以选择任何密码。我对这个网站几乎没有任何限制,因为这些数据都不是私人或个人的。 ..

在 Django admin 中编辑组对象时将用户对象分配给组

在用户对象(编辑用户)的默认 Django 管理视图中,可以编辑用户的组成员身份.如果我也想反过来呢?IE.在群组编辑页面中,可以选择属于正在编辑的群组的用户. 正如我所看到的,Django 没有从 Group 到 User 对象的 ManyToMany 映射,这使得(?)无法为这种特殊情况实现 ModelAdmin 类.如果我可以创建一个额外的 UsersOfGroup 模型类并在 Dja ..
发布时间:2022-01-25 11:46:55 其他开发

如何从数据库和身份验证用户中撤回加盐密码?

这是我第一次尝试使用全部存储在数据库 (MySQL) 中的加盐密码来实现会员网站.除了“会员登录"页面中的错误之外,一切正常. 错误:会员登录页面接受会员网站的任何条目,并且由于某种原因通过了我对 $result === false 的检查 这是检查成员是否存在的代码,请告诉我问题所在: $servername = 'localhost';$用户名 = 'root';$pwd = '' ..
发布时间:2022-01-21 23:50:44 PHP

检查 Python 列表中是否有(不)某些东西

我有一个 Python 中的元组列表,并且我有一个条件仅当元组不在列表中时,我才想采用分支(如果它在列表中,那么我不想采用 if 分支) 如果 curr_x -1 >0 和 (curr_x-1 , curr_y) 不在 myList 中:# 做一点事 不过,这对我来说并不适用.我做错了什么? 解决方案 错误可能在代码中的其他地方,因为它应该可以正常工作: >>>3 不在 [2, 3, ..
发布时间:2022-01-20 23:07:40 Python

Python 的 in (__contains__) 运算符返回一个布尔值,其值既不是 True 也不是 False

正如所料,1 不包含在空元组中 >>>1 英寸 ()错误的 但是返回的False值不等于False >>>1 in () == 假错误的 换个角度看,in 运算符返回一个 bool,它既不是 True 也不是 False: >>>类型(1 在())>>>1 英寸 () == 真,1 英寸 () == 假(假,假) 但是,如果原始表达式被括号括起来,则正常行为会恢复 > ..
发布时间:2022-01-19 16:52:43 Python

无法更改 Xcode 4.5 中的目标成员身份可见性

我目前尝试在我的应用程序中排除我的应用程序内购买逻辑,以使其可在我的其他应用程序中重复使用,甚至将其放在公共 git 存储库中供其他人使用.为此,我遵循了在 XCode 中创建框架的本指南. 但在 第 2 步我必须将我的 .h 文件的 Target Membership 设置为 public.问题是,在我的 Xcode (v 4.5) 中,单击 .h 文件时看不到任何可见性(当我单击 .m ..
发布时间:2022-01-14 19:39:50 移动开发

从 web.config 读取成员资格部分

我已经创建了一个自定义 MembershipProvider 类,到目前为止还不错,但是,我不知道如何从 web.config 文件中读取配置设置. 我尝试从 Google 和 Stackoverflow 进行搜索,似乎有人也遇到了我的问题问题并询问,但没有给出答案. 这应该是一件简单的事情,但我在 Web 开发方面很新,所以从 web.config 读取设置对我来说似乎太技术性了. ..
发布时间:2021-12-21 15:30:35 C#/.NET

如何在会话超时或结束时注销用户

在会话结束或过期时注销用户的最佳方法是什么? 感谢您的帮助. 解决方案 这实际上取决于您正在寻找的所需功能.我假设您使用的是 FormsAuthentication. 您需要关注两件独立的事情:Session 和 FormsAuthentication cookie.除非我弄错了,否则两者都有不同的超时时间. 如果您遇到的问题是会话超时但用户仍通过身份验证,您可以尝试以下 ..
发布时间:2021-12-15 21:26:37 C#/.NET

python中的神秘for循环

令 exp = [1,2,3,4,5] 如果我然后在 exp 中执行 x,它会给我 False.但是如果我执行: for x in exp:如果 x==3:打印('真') 然后执行x in exp,返回True.这里发生了什么事?我没有给 x 分配任何东西.我有吗?我真的很困惑. **EDIT:**对不起,如果我之前没有说过:x 之前没有定义. 答案 谢谢大家.我现在明 ..
发布时间:2021-12-11 13:08:55 Python

检查 Python 中的列表中是否有(不)某些内容

我在 Python 中有一个元组列表,并且我有一个条件只有当元组不在列表中时,我才想采用分支(如果它在列表中,那么我不想采用 if 分支) if curr_x -1 >0 和 (curr_x-1 , curr_y) 不在 myList 中:# 做点什么 虽然这对我来说并不真正有效.我做错了什么? 解决方案 该错误可能在您代码中的其他地方,因为它应该可以正常工作: >>>3 不在 [2 ..
发布时间:2021-12-06 13:37:56 Python

ASP.NET 成员资格使用的默认哈希算法是什么?

ASP.NET 成员资格使用的默认哈希算法是什么?我该如何更改它? 解决方案 编辑:不要按原样使用 Membership Provider,因为它在保护用户密码方面严重不足 鉴于谷歌搜索“会员提供商哈希算法" 将这个答案作为第一个结果,以及将推断出的福音,我有必要警告人们不要像这样使用会员提供程序并使用 SHA-1、MD5 等哈希来混淆数据库中的密码. tl;博士 使用密钥派 ..
发布时间:2021-11-30 17:43:32 C#/.NET

您如何在应用程序域之间传递经过身份验证的会话

假设您有网站 www.xyz.com 和 www.abc.com. 假设用户访问 www.abc.com 并通过普通的 ASP .NET 成员资格提供程序进行身份验证. 然后,从该站点,他们被发送到(重定向、链接、任何有效的)站点 www.xyz.com,站点 www.abc.com 的意图是将该用户作为状态传递到另一个站点isAuthenticated,这样网站 www.xyz.co ..
发布时间:2021-11-29 08:15:45 C#/.NET

是否可以使用 Membership API 更改用户名

我在 ASP.NET 中使用默认的 sql 成员资格提供程序,我想提供一个页面来更改用户的用户名.我相信我可以使用自定义提供程序执行此操作,但可以使用默认提供程序执行此操作吗? 我的问题的第二部分是:我应该允许用户在创建帐户后更改其用户名吗? 解决方案 默认的 SQL Membership Provider 确实不允许更改用户名.但是,如果您在您的站点上有一个有效的参数允许它,则没有 ..

如何将 Membership API 与自己的应用程序相关数据结合使用?

在 asp.net 4 中设计新应用程序 我必须决定如何使用 MS SQL Membership API 以及我自己在 MS SQL 数据库中的数据.首先,我需要以更灵活的方式存储和访问用户配置文件数据,然后配置文件提供程序支持.其次,我想链接其他用户相关信息(例如订单). 无论您将 aspnetdb 表存储在何处(在单独的数据库中或与数据位于同一数据库中),问题仍然是如何保持数据同步. ..

将一个 Asp.net Membership 数据库与多个应用程序一起使用 Single Sign On

我在一台 IIS 服务器上有两个 asp.net 应用程序,我想使用相同的后端 asp_security 数据库和成员资格提供程序.我已经读到我所要做的就是在两个 Web 配置中引用相同的应用程序名称,就像我现在所做的那样,但我一定是做错了什么 在每个应用程序 web.config 中,我都有这个部分. ..
发布时间:2021-11-29 08:12:28 C#/.NET